#162fa9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#162fa9 is composed of 8.6% red, 18.4%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87% cyan, 72.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 229.8 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 37.5%. #162fa9 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c5eff with #000053.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#162fa9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#162fa9 has RGB values of R:22, G:47, B:169 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 1453993.

Shades and Tints of #162fa9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02040d is the darkest color, while #fafb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#162fa9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f5f60 is the less saturated color, while #0725b8 is the most saturated one.
